render-deploy-diffDetect config drift between required local env keys and a Render service before deploy; fails when required keys are missing remotely.

A SaaS company uses this skill in CI/CD pipelines to validate environment configuration before deploying updates to production services on Render. It ensures that new deployments won't fail due to missing environment variables, reducing downtime and deployment errors.
An e-commerce platform with multiple microservices on Render runs this skill before each service deployment to check for config drift. This prevents issues like broken payment integrations or missing API keys that could disrupt customer transactions.
A web development agency deploys client projects on Render and uses this skill to verify that all required environment variables are set correctly across staging and production environments. It helps maintain consistency and avoid configuration mismatches during client handoffs.
A tech startup launching an MVP on Render integrates this skill into their deployment script to ensure critical environment keys (e.g., database URLs, API tokens) are present before going live. This reduces the risk of application crashes during initial user testing.
A healthcare application hosted on Render uses this skill to audit environment configurations before deployments, ensuring sensitive data keys (e.g., encryption secrets) are properly set to meet regulatory compliance standards like HIPAA.

💬 Integration Tip
Integrate this skill into your CI/CD pipeline by setting required environment variables in your workflow configuration and running the script as a pre-deployment step to catch config issues early.
